Job Responsibilities 

This position will involve developing and coordinating functional testing of multi-stack equipment and multi-redundant system configurations within a trade. You will review criteria, specifications, drawings, equipment submittals, and other documentation pertinent to commissioning. 

Additional Responsibilities: 

  • Develop and coordinate Commissioning Plans, consistent with ASHRAE Guideline O format.
  • Develop and coordinate functional testing of multi-stack equipment and multi-redundant system configurations within a trade.
  • Review design criteria, specifications, drawings, equipment submittals, and other documentation pertinent to commissioning and provide a peer review level of feedback.
  • The ability to lead commissioning efforts with multiple trades and client management involvement
  • Technical writing ability to create and Operating Procedures and Technical instruction material
  • Oversight of 1 - 2 engineers on projects reporting to them

Job Requirements 

To succeed in this role, your experience would include commissioning of large Mechanical systems for industrial, data center, commercial, operations center, high-rise and healthcare type facilities. Your technical strengths must be complemented by self-motivation, relationship building skills, and effective communication skills. 

Commissioning Engineer requirements: 

  • Bachelor’s Degree in Mechanical Engineering or required years of experience, including the commissioning of large distribution systems for industrial, data center, commercial, operations center, high-rise and healthcare type facilities. 
  • A minimum of 6 years of field experience in hands-on testing, validation, and troubleshooting of large Mechanical systems 
  • 3.5+ - 8 years of relevant experience in the MEP field 
  • Possesses a basic understanding of proper system selection 
  • Exhibits a basic understanding of the practical application of LEED principles to building designs 
  • Exhibits a thorough understanding of applicable codes 
  • Experience with ASHRAE, BCxA, and/or PECI Cx and RETRO-Cx procedures and protocols, a plus 
  • PE or recognized commissioning certification preferred.

What you need to know about the Charlotte Tech Scene

Ranked among the hottest tech cities in 2024 by CompTIA, Charlotte is quickly cementing its place as a major U.S. tech hub. Home to more than 90,000 tech workers, the city’s ecosystem is primed for continued growth, fueled by billions in annual funding from heavyweights like Microsoft and RevTech Labs, which has created thousands of fintech jobs and made the city a go-to for tech pros looking for their next big opportunity.

Key Facts About Charlotte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 90,859; 6.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lowe’s, Bank of America, TIAA, Microsoft, Honeywell
  • Key Industries: Fintech, artificial intelligence, cybersecurity, cloud computing, e-commerce
  • Funding Landscape: $3.1 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(CED)
  • Notable Investors: Microsoft, Google, Falfurrias Management Partners, RevTech Labs Foundation
  • Research Centers and Universities: University of North Carolina at Charlotte, Northeastern University, North Carolina Research Campus
